ELECTRO-VOICE® INTRODUCES NEW EVID™ C12.2 CEILING LOUDSPEAKER AT NSCA 2007 (Booth 1307)
Orlando, Florida, (March 15TH, 2007): The Electro-Voice® EVID™ C12.2 loudspeaker system is a high efficiency two-way ceiling loudspeaker pacakage for high ceiling applications.
The C12.2 has an array of outstanding features. The loudspeaker features the EVID 920-8B transducer, as 12“ coaxial with high power handling and 100 dB sensitivity. The integrated 64W transformer allows for use in 70V/100V applications, and included automatic saturation compensation. Transformer tap selection is via a convenient switch on the front baffle. The perforated grille is finished in semi-gloss white powder-coated enamel. The baffle and bezel are constructed from UL 94V-0 rated ABS. The rear enclosure is constructed from heavy guage steel, and has a durable black powder-coat that blends in when used in open-ceiling applications. The rear enclosure provides an optimum internal volume for extended low-frequency performance.
KEY FEATURES:
· High 100 dB sensitivity
· High 100W power handling
· Wide, smooth 85 Hz - 18 kHz frequency response
· Four-pin Quick Disconnect Phoenix Connector
· Integrated 3/8“ threaded rod and pendant mount rigging points for use in open ceiling applications‘
· 64W transformer with automatic saturation compensation for 70V/100V operation
· Includes tile bridge and mounting ring for easy installation into tile ceilings
